ERP Detector using Texture Filters and Tucker Decomposition
Vision is the dominant sensory channel by which humans acquire external information. Understanding how the human brain responds to a visual stimulus will help us develop better brain-machine interfaces and describe the human-brain activity response. One technique for tracking brain activity is functional mag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I) using blood-oxygen-level-dependent imaging or BOLD-contrast imaging to show the blood oxygenation in the brain before, during and after a stimulus. Identifying the brain activity provoked by a given stimulus is a topic in different research centers.When popular classifiers do not provide perfect accuracy in a practical application, possible causes of their failure can be deficiencies in the algorithms and intrinsic difficulties in the data. In machine and deep learning, models mostly remain black boxes; convolutional neural networks (CNN) are no exception. This understanding of the design of the machine-learning pipeline and the feature-extraction process will provide insight into what a classification model could be.
